Web25 de set. de 2015 · Dashes, like colons, can also introduce lists and explanations. Both of these sentences are correct: RIGHT: I’m headed to the store: I need milk and eggs. RIGHT: I’m headed to the store–I need milk and eggs. WebHá 2 dias · An unspaced dash (i.e. with no space before or after it) is used: to indicate a range. pages 26–42. between two adjectives or noun modifiers that indicate that two … WebIn the early 17th century, in Okes-printed plays of William Shakespeare, dashes are attested that indicate a thinking pause, interruption, mid-speech realization, or change of subject. The dashes are variously longer ⸺ (as in King Lear reprinted 1619) or composed of hyphens ---(as in Othello printed 1622); moreover, the dashes are often, but not always, …
